Book Summary

'the philippine independent missions to the us 1919-1934' by b. churchill explores the diplomatic efforts and political strategies employed by the philippines in its quest for independence from american colonization. the book delves into the series of missions sent by filipino leaders to the united states to negotiate terms and advocate for self-governance. it provides detailed account of the challenges faced, the evolving political landscape, and the ultimate impact of these missions on philippine-american relations and the eventual path to philippine independence.
